Intenta arrancar el navegador desactivando los ajustes de seguridad. De este modo no se comprobaran las CORS y no debería darte error.

Si usas Mac puedes arrancar Chrome con los ajustes deshabilitados con la siguiente instrucción en la terminal:

"/Applications/Google Chrome.app/Contents/MacOS/Google Chrome" --disable-web-security --user-data-dir

Una vez abierto verás que aparece un mensaje arriba indicando que estas en modo "no seguro".

Abre http://localhost:4200 para visualizar tu aplicación y el error de CORS no debería aparecer.
